Hybrid Senior .NET Engineer

Posted 13 hours ago

Apply now

About the role

  • Senior .NET Engineer at Reconomy’s tech hub in Bucharest, focusing on developing features and improving legacy systems while mentoring other developers.

Responsibilities

  • Take ownership of features and changes from requirement through to production
  • Deliver complete, production-ready solutions, not partial implementations
  • Work effectively with legacy codebases, making safe, incremental improvements
  • Identify opportunities to improve structure, performance, and maintainability over time
  • Develop and maintain applications across:
  • .NET Framework (MVC / WebForms / legacy services)
  • Emerging modern components (.NET 8+, APIs, cloud services)
  • Make pragmatic decisions on:
  • When to extend existing systems
  • When to refactor
  • When to introduce new patterns
  • Avoid over-engineering while still moving the platform forward
  • Apply strong engineering principles:
  • SOLID
  • Separation of concerns
  • Testability where practical
  • Review existing implementations before building new solutions to:
  • Avoid duplication
  • Maintain consistency across systems
  • Improve code quality incrementally rather than attempting large rewrites
  • Work with, create and improve existing CI/CD pipelines (GitHub Actions)
  • Ensure solutions are deployable and stable across:
  • Development
  • Test
  • Production environments
  • Troubleshoot issues across environments with a pragmatic, end-to-end mindset
  • Provide guidance and mentoring to other developers
  • Carry out meaningful code reviews focused on:
  • Logic and approach
  • Not just syntax
  • Help raise the overall engineering standard of the team

Requirements

  • Strong experience in C# / .NET (particularly .NET Framework)
  • Experience working in and maintaining legacy systems
  • Good understanding of modern .NET and web development practices
  • Ability to balance:
  • Short-term delivery needs
  • Long-term maintainability
  • Exposure to Azure (App Services, configuration, monitoring)
  • Exposure to Kubernetes
  • Experience working across mixed/transitioning architectures
  • Knowledge of:
  • WCF / legacy integrations
  • REST API design
  • Experience improving CI/CD pipelines

Benefits

  • This role offers you the chance to work in a friendly, diverse and international environment, along with colleagues who will share your passion for innovation, agile-working and growth. You will also be able to develop your skills within the exciting and challenging market of Reverse Logistics!
  • Hybrid working environment
  • Training and development to keep you in touch with the latest technologies and the opportunities to apply your learning.
  • We offer a competitive salary alongside other benefits*
  • Our office is easily accessible located near the city center of Bucharest, and designed to make you feel at home
  • 21 working days of annual leave, plus 2 additional days allowed for participation in volunteering programs, and 1 extra day off for your birthday
  • Meal vouchers: 40 RON per working day (taxed according to current legislation)
  • Private medical subscription at Medicover.

Job title

Senior .NET Engineer

Job type

Experience level

Senior

Salary

Not specified

Degree requirement

Bachelor's Degree

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job